Gerdau Floats New Company to Operate in the Graphene Market

Retrieved on: 
Wednesday, April 28, 2021

b'SO PAULO, April 28, 2021 /PRNewswire/ -- Gerdau inaugurated a new company today called Gerdau Graphene, which will develop and market products based on graphene applications.

Graphene Market by Type, Application, End-use Industry and Region - Global Forecast to 2025

Retrieved on: 
Thursday, April 1, 2021

The global graphene market size is projected to grow from USD 620 million in 2020 to USD 1,479 million by 2025, at a CAGR of 19.0% between 2020 and 2025.

2D Electronics Could Be One Drop Away: WPI-MANA

Retrieved on: 
Monday, March 22, 2021

However, further development of 2D materials depends on finding deposition processes that enable precise layer-by-layer control of thin films while reducing time, cost and energy/sample consumption.

Key Points: 
  • However, further development of 2D materials depends on finding deposition processes that enable precise layer-by-layer control of thin films while reducing time, cost and energy/sample consumption.
  • The team found that a simple one-drop approach improves "drop casting" fabrication of tiled nanosheets.
  • Drop casting is one of the most versatile and cost-effective methods of depositing nanomaterials on solid surfaces.
  • This research was carried out by Minoru Osada (NIMS Invited Researcher, Soft Chemistry Group, WPI-MANA, NIMS) and his collaborators.
